热门话题
#
Bonk 生态迷因币展现强韧势头
#
有消息称 Pump.fun 计划 40 亿估值发币,引发市场猜测
#
Solana 新代币发射平台 Boop.Fun 风头正劲
你可以申请住房......
使用ZKPs(@hyli_org和@NoirLang)....
这是它的工作原理👇

@hyli_org @NoirLang 大卫,@hyli_org 的资助者,开发了 zkTenant,这是一个用于法国住房申请的零知识应用程序。它使用户能够在不披露原始数据的情况下证明收入等级和法国国籍。
该系统使用 Noir,并利用法国政府的 2D-Doc 格式。
@hyli_org @NoirLang 2D-Doc 是一种基于二维码的数字签名方案,用于法国官方文件(身份证、纳税申报表等)。它使用 ECDSA (p256) 对明文内容进行签名,并将其嵌入为条形码。
挑战:客户端在浏览器中对这些签名进行 ZK 验证。
@hyli_org @NoirLang 为了解决这个问题,David 创建了一个 Noir 库,可以在浏览器中完全解析和验证 2D-Doc 条形码。没有服务器依赖。所有证明都是通过 WASM 在本地生成的。
这符合数据主权和验证透明度的限制。
@hyli_org @NoirLang 客户端 ECDSA zk 证明是 RAM 密集型的。之前的基准测试(例如,弗拉德)显示了 Noir 的可行性。证明生成被碎片化为更小的递归组件,以保持在 WASM 限制范围内。
这实现了高性能的浏览器内证明。
@hyli_org @NoirLang zkTenant 工作流:
- 输入:姓名、纳税年度、应税收入。
- 扫描件:法国身份证和税务申报表(2D-Doc)。
- @NoirLang生成收入等级 + 公民身份的证明。
- 输出:可重复使用的 ZK 证明,目前可在应用程序内模拟。
@hyli_org @NoirLang 与 @hyli_org 的集成允许可组合的 zkProofs。ID 和收入证明都可以捆绑到单个 blob 中。这支持模块化升级(例如,护照而不是身份证),而无需重新构建证明逻辑。
@hyli_org @NoirLang 隐私模式:原始文件永远不会离开客户。只有提取数据的经过验证的哈希值才会提交到链上。零原始数据暴露,完全可审计。
4.45K
热门
排行
收藏